Transaction 586d0377c57821f16c2d61c70b40e10b68e606fbcb90a64e839bf6e3fab7669a

1 Input
2 Outputs
  • 586d0377c57821f16c2d61c70b40e10b68e606fbcb90a64e839bf6e3fab7669a:0
  • value  213038
    address  1FBjv5SN8gYkdVAJ694Ku6f8DjhREob23g
  • 586d0377c57821f16c2d61c70b40e10b68e606fbcb90a64e839bf6e3fab7669a:1
  • value  543930
    address  1K7QYSGJoaJVYsUdZVQ839YmGQX4gUkLU4